Abstract HDUST is a radiative transfer code developed by prof. Alex Carciofi in collaboration with prof. Jon Bjorkman (U. of Toledo, EUA). The goal of the project is to upgrade HDUST in order to model, for the first time, the effect of a secondary companion orbiting a Be star primary and its disk. (AU) | |
